Home insurance underwriters consider credit scores, personal claims history and property claims history when writing new policies and calculating annual premiums. To keep the process fair, states have imposed limits on how much insurance companies can charge and how far back they can look on your credit records. In most cases, insurers review your history for the past five years when underwriting new policies. Checking your credit report before shopping for online homeowners insurance quotes can help prevent errors from increasing your home insurance rates. If you are shopping for homes, it pays to ask the current owner for a copy of the home's CLUE report, which details all insurance claims for the property. The CLUE report will give you a clear idea of the type of claims your home has experienced and how much insurance companies might charge you to protect the property.
Reviewing your coverage needs is one of most important aspects for controlling home insurance costs. Basic home insurance is designed to protect your dwelling and buildings in case of fire, damage caused by the electrical system, plumbing and other building components. Many people pay to ensure their entire property, including the land, for the appraised value. To curb unnecessary spending, financial gurus recommend insuring only your home and its contents. When applying for online homeowners insurance quotes, providers have several different methods for calculating coverage based on the actual replacement costs or current cash value of your possessions.
Raising the deductible of your homeowners insurance policy is one of the most effective ways to find home insurance quotes with lower annual premiums. Understanding when to file a claim and when to cover repairs yourself is very important for determining how high your deductible should be.
Depending on the level of coverage, your online homeowners insurance quote will include a list of covered items or a list of exclusions, such as flooding and earthquakes. Understanding your coverage benefits is extremely important for accurately comparing policies and annual premiums.
